Sr Software Engineer, Employee Experience & Productivity

at  Apple

Austin, Texas, USA -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ate22 Jul, 2024Not Specified29 Apr, 20245 year(s) or aboveLegacy Systems,Design Patterns,Rest,Travel Systems,Gds,Spring Framework,Junit,Communication Skills,Global Distribution Systems,Sql,Data Structures,Computer Science,OracleN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

SUMMARY

Posted: Dec 19, 2023
Role Number:200528542
Imagine what you could do here. At Apple, great ideas have a way of becoming great products, services, and customer experiences very quickly. Bring passion and dedication to your job and there’s no telling what you could accomplish. Want to build and manage the systems that provide Travel & Expense Reimbursements services to Apple? Want to help Apple work through an ever-evolving T&E landscape? If so, Apple T&E Engineering is looking for an exceptional Software Engineer who is passionate about delivering innovative solutions to meet Apple’s travel and expense reimbursement needs.

KEY QUALIFICATIONS

  • 8+ years software development experience
  • Very strong skills with Java (J2EE / J2SE) and related technologies: Spring Framework, JUnit
  • Application development and design experience using object-oriented methodologies
  • Hands on experience building and using REST APIs
  • Experience with Oracle, data replication, SQL and PL/SQL
  • Experience in building new micro-services platforms on cloud environments
  • Highly organized, someone who thrives working in a fast-paced environment, and loves learning new technologies
  • Obsessively passionate and inquisitive, and seeks to solve everyday problems in innovative ways
  • Excellent knowledge of data structures, algorithms, design patterns, enterprise architecture and software engineering principles
  • Poses excellent communication skills and can influence cross functionally
  • A passion for 24/7 global operational transaction platforms
  • Experience with travel Global Distribution Systems (GDS), back office travel systems or payment legacy systems.

DESCRIPTION

Your responsibilities will include all aspects of software development management, from design and analysis to development, implementation and maintenance. You must be a proactive and hardworking individual. As a Senior Software Engineer, you will be a contributing member of a team that implements new product features, improves existing product features, while adding performance and software quality metrics to our codebase. You will work closely with business partners, other engineering teams, quality assurance, management, as well as human interface and user experience designers. YOUR DUTIES WILL INCLUDE : Architect creative products, and innovate new technologies & solutions, play a hands-on development and design role, and deliver product in a rapid and dynamic environment - Design and develop highly scalable, reliable and secure Java applications - Design and develop RESTFUL WebServices - Collaborate with peers, including the iOS client team, on technical design, work estimation and implementation of new features - Quickly build new ideas to get new user feedback - Collaborate with other engineers on code reviews, internal infrastructure, and process enhancements - Work with project managers and technical teams, in a cross-functional environment, to implement quality products that meet the business goals.

EDUCATION & EXPERIENCE

BS degree in computer science or equivalent field with 8+ years or MS degree with 5+ years experience, or equivalent

ADDITIONAL REQUIREMENTS

Additional Requirement

Responsibilities:

Please refer the Job description for details


REQUIREMENT SUMMARY

Min:5.0Max:8.0 year(s)

Computer Software/Engineering

IT Software - Application Programming / Maintenance

Software Engineering

BSc

Computer Science

Proficient

1

Austin, TX, USA